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technician arrives at your property to assess the situation and contain the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to prevent further water from entering the affected area and ensure your safety.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
We’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to remove standing water and dry out your property. Our technicians are trained to work efficiently and effectively, reducing downtime and getting you back to normal as soon as possible.
Step 3: Dehumidification and Drying
We’ll use specialized equipment to dehumidify the air and dry out your belongings.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th, which can lead to further damage and health risks.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ll sanitize and disinfect the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Our technicians use specialized equipment and chemicals to ensure your property is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certificate
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is dry and safe. We’ll provide you with a certificate of completion, guaranteeing our work and giving you peace of mind.

Q: What causes aquarium leaks?
A: Aquarium le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including cracked glass, faulty equipment, and improper installation.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ent leaks and ensure your aquarium remains safe and healthy.
